The Evolution of Dynamic Gameplay Mechanics

Modern game designers have masterfully shifted their focus from static rulebooks to organic, evolving gameplay experiences. Legacy and campaign-style games now allow choices made in one session to permanently alter the physical landscape of future playthroughs. This constant sense of consequence keeps the community deeply invested in the long-term outcomes of their strategic decisions.

Furthermore, modular board setups and variable player powers ensure that no two setups are identical. Players must constantly analyze new combinations of abilities and terrain, which naturally sharpens real-world tactical thinking. This innate variability provides a robust foundation for sustainable and repeatable home entertainment.

Cultivating Problem Solving Through Interaction

Engaging regularly with complex tabletop systems serves as an excellent mental exercise for individuals of all skill levels. These games require players to manage limited resources, calculate risk percentages, and predict their opponents' long-term movements. Over time, navigating these virtual crises builds resilience and sharpens cognitive flexibility.

Additionally, cooperative titles encourage teams to communicate clearly and delegate responsibilities based on individual strengths. Working together to solve an intricate puzzle fosters genuine camaraderie and deepens social bonds among friends and family. This shared intellectual challenge is exactly why the hobby continues to experience a massive global resurgence.

Curating a Library for Endless Replayability

Building a collection that offers long-term discovery involves selecting titles that prioritize mechanical depth over superficial flash. Look for designs that include randomized setup elements, hidden objectives, or multiple paths to achieving victory. These features ensure that even after dozens of sessions, players can still find fresh tactics to master.

Investing in high-quality components and thoughtful expansions can also breathe new life into an established favorite.
